Trip Overview

The drive from Tornillo, TX to Austin, TX covers 543.2 miles and takes about 8h 24m behind the wheel. It usually feels better as a 2-day road trip than as one long push.

The route leans on O T Smith Road, US 290 East, Highway 290 for much of the mileage, and the overall profile is long-distance drive. At current regular gas prices, budget about $82.98 one way before food or hotel costs.

Seasonal Notes

Summer travel usually means heavier construction, hotter rest stops, and busier weekend traffic around major cities.

Winter travel shortens daylight, so a route that looks manageable on paper can feel much longer after dark.

Holiday weekends tend to make both departure and arrival windows slower than the raw route time suggests.

For long drives, weather on day two can matter just as much as conditions at departure, so check the whole travel window rather than only the first day.
